WebScarlet-fever type rash - blanching, sandpaper-like rash, usually more prominent in skin creases, flushed face/cheeks with peri-oral pallor (GAS) Red flags Unwell/toxic appearance Respiratory distress Stridor Trismus … WebSep 12, 2024 · Perichondritis appears as soft tissue edema and hyperemia around the cartilage of the auricle. Progression to cartilage involvement (chondritis) appears as thickening and hyperemia of the cartilage itself. Treatment and prognosis The treatment involves systemic antibiotics including pseudomonal coverage 3.

WebOct 7, 2024 · Perichondritis is an infection of the connective tissue of the ear that covers the cartilaginous auricle or pinna, excluding the lobule. ( Ear Nose Throat J. 2014;93 [2]:E4.) The term perichondritis is a misnomer because the cartilage is almost always involved with abscess formation and cavitation. ( J Laryngol Otol. 2007;121 [6]:530.)
